Job Category: Administration and Office,Environmental Services,HR & Recruitment Dynamic and Fast Paced Supportive, Customer-focused, and Fun Be part of an environment where our values underpin everything we do Waitaha - our Canterbury region - is like no other and we are proud to call it home. We are privileged to be working with Nga Papatipu Runanga, stakeholders, and our wider community to protect our environment, including water, land, and air through regulation and planning. As a Regional Council we're responsible for flood protection, public transport, civil defence, and more. Together we're taking action to shape a thriving and resilient Canterbury, now and for future generations.
